Cow Bones Discovered at Needham Construction Site

A construction crew told police that bones were found at their work site on Second Avenue.

NEEDHAM, MA — The remains of an animal were found in Needham Tuesday morning.

At about 9 a.m., a construction crew told police that bones were found at their work site on Second Avenue. Pictures of the bones were sent to the state forensic anthropologist and it was determined that the bones belonged to a cow.

No other information was released.
